Understanding Delta 8 THC Flower

Delta 8 THC flower, often referred to simply as "Delta 8 flower," is a cannabis product that contains Delta 8 THC as its primary cannabinoid. It is important to note that Delta 8 THC is a distinct compound from its more famous cousin, Delta 9 THC, though they share structural similarities.

 

Delta 8 THC flower is typically derived from hemp plants, making it legal under the 2018 Farm Bill in the United States as long as it contains less than 0.3% Delta 9 THC. This makes it a potentially attractive option for those seeking the benefits of Delta 8 THC without the intense high associated with Delta 9 THC.

The Science Behind Delta 8 THC

Delta 8 THC interacts with the body's endocannabinoid system, similar to Delta 9 THC. This system plays a crucial role in maintaining balance and homeostasis within the body. When Delta 8 THC binds to cannabinoid receptors, primarily CB1 receptors, it can produce various effects on the nervous system. These effects are believed to underlie the potential therapeutic benefits of Delta 8 THC.

Legal Status and Considerations

The legal status of Delta 8 THC flower varies from place to place. While it is federally legal in the United States under certain conditions, state laws may differ. It's crucial to be aware of and adhere to local regulations before purchasing or using Delta 8 THC flower.
